This morning I got my Glossybox through the post, which is always a bonus. A few days ago I got an email from them saying that this months box features products from Harrod's, so I was quite excited and interested to see what they would include!


This month's included 'Vanitas Versace' Versace Eau de Parfum, Bliss Blood Orange and White Pepper Body Butter, Revive Intensite Creme Lustre SPF30, Lancome Juicy tubes in Toffee R'n'B 93 and Clarins Extra Firming Body Cream.




I was a bit skeptical about the Eau de Parfum, because I'm quite particular in what I like to wear perfume wise and I'm not a fan of anything too musky or heavy. But this is great, I would definitely recommend it to anyone that fancies a chance. It's light, but you only need a little dabbed on for it to go a long way. Its a very floral perfume but has a lovely lime twist scent to it. You could easily use it during the day and for going out in the evening too, very versatile!

I have to say I felt relieved to see the body butter didn't have cocoa butter in it like every other body butter and I want to try something new. This is gorgeous, left my skin feeling silky smooth and it wasn't too heavy unlike some cocoa body butters you get that can feel very thick and suffocating to your skin. Will be using every last bit of this one!

You can never go wrong with Clarins, although the price of their products always puts me off. I applied this before I put on my make up and it instantly made my skin feel hydrated, firm and not greasy at all! The cream is quite thick so you dont need a lot at all. Almost ten hours later my skin still feels smooth, soft, and firm.

Last month's Glossybox included a Venom lipgloss, which I fell in love with so was quite optimistic when I saw the Lancome Juicy Tube sample. It is a thick lipgloss, and can be quite sticky but it smells gorgeous and looks lovely! It's a really good colour to wear during the day too!

I also got two Clinique goodies with this month's Cosmopolitan - 'Moisture Surge', a gel cream that can be applied either as a mask or whenever required, and their 'High Impact' mascara. The gel cream is perfect for touching up make up when I'm at work and my skin needs a quick pick me up, or as a base before applying my foundation. It feels a bit watery when you first apply it but it quickly soaks in leaving your skin refreshed. I was really surprised with the High Impact mascara, as I didn't expect too much from it but the actual mascara wand is fab! It separates my lashes with absolutely no problem, and gives a even thick coverage which I love. A great mascara for when you need to apply your make up quickly or for touching up.
